I'm handing the dynamic ticket-pricing experiment over as of this sprint. For plugin authors: the experiment flag `fareline.tiered_v2` alters the price-quote payload shape — a `tierContext` object is appended when the flag is active, and legacy plugins that strictly validate the schema will reject it. A compatibility shim exists but is off by default. Migration notes and the rollout calendar are in the shared runbook. Direct all integration questions and breakage reports to the new owner named below.

signatory, baweg-bahip: Sildor Aldath Caseth

Briefing: Vexhall Term Sheet — Leadership Review

For the incoming director.

Vexhall Systems proposes a three-year co-development deal: shared IP on the Corrant module, 12% revenue split, exclusivity in the Tormond region. Legal flags the exclusivity clause; finance accepts the split. Counterproposal due in ten days.

Recommendation: accept with narrowed exclusivity.

The confidential note on our broader positioning appears below.

internal memo for kawip-hadug: Headcount on the Wenwyn team goes from 7 to 140 by the end of January. Gross margin on Wenwyn came in at 20 percent against a plan of 15 percent.

Handover — J. Relk to S. Dunmore, Directors, Copperfen Foods

Franchise agreement with Marlowe's Kitchens signed; ten-year term, royalties at 6%. Fit-out costs for the Dettbury site sit with the franchisee. Finance to set up the royalty ledger this month. Audit rights exercisable annually. Outstanding: insurance schedule confirmation. See the planning note below before any disbursements.

confidential, kagep-kahof: Druokax Systems plans to lower the Ulaath list price by 53 percent in March.

Splitting the user module out of the Hollowgate monolith looks right, but the extraction service needs backpressure before we merge. Right now the sync job reads the whole users table in one pass — that will stall replication on the primary. Chunk it, add a sleep between batches, and cap concurrent workers. Also: dual-write window should be short; flag it per-tenant. I hardcoded nothing; everything you'd want to adjust lives in the constants below.

tuning table, yajog-yahof:
BUDGETS = {
    "lamvan": 303,
    "wenox": 460,
    "fenvan": 525,
}